ALLEN v. NEBRASKA LIQUOR CONTROL COMMISSION

No. 36089.

140 N.W.2d 413 (1966)

179 Neb. 767

J. Tom ALLEN and Robert A. Weigel, Appellants, v. NEBRASKA LIQUOR CONTROL COMMISSION, Appellee.

Supreme Court of Nebraska.

February 25, 1966.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Richard H. Hansen, Robert A. Weigel, Lincoln, for appellants.

Clarence A. H. Meyer, Atty. Gen., Robert R. Camp, Asst. Atty. Gen., Lincoln, for appellee.

Heard before WHITE, C. J., and CARTER, SPENCER, BOSLAUGH, BROWER, SMITH, and McCOWN, JJ.


CARTER, Justice.

On March 12, 1964, the applicants filed a joint application for a package liquor license with the Nebraska Liquor Control Commission. After a hearing the commission denied the application and the applicants appealed.
